American Surrogacy Expenses: Understanding the Financial Landscape

Navigating the financial landscape of American surrogacy can be complex and overwhelming. Numerous|Various factors influence the total cost, including the surrogate's location, medical costs, legal charges, and specialist fees.

The average cost of surrogacy in the United States can range from approximately $50,000 to over $100,000. This wide variation reflects the diverse factors mentioned above.

It's crucial for prospective parents to conduct thorough research and consult with experienced professionals to develop a comprehensive budget.

A detailed breakdown of surrogacy charges typically includes:

* Surrogate compensation and benefits

* Agency fees

* Legal fees

* Medical expenses for both the surrogate and intended individual

* Travel and accommodation costs

* Insurance coverage

Understanding these elements can help potential parents make informed decisions and plan financially for their surrogacy journey.

Factors Influencing American Surrogacy Expenses

The expense of surrogacy in America can fluctuate dramatically due to a multitude of variables. Regulatory fees vary from state to state, impacting the overall budget. The region where the surrogate and intended parents reside also plays a role, with major metropolitan areas often having higher costs. Medical expenses can be substantial, covering pre-implantation genetic testing (PGT), fertility treatments, prenatal care, and delivery. The surrogate's payment is another essential factor, reflecting her time commitment, expertise, and the extent of the surrogacy arrangement.
